This brings us to the "Three poisons" of Body, Speech and Mind. There are ten Non-virtuous actions that bring about bad Kharma.

3 of the Body

Killing, stealing and sexual misconduct.

4 of Speech

Lying, devise of speech or slander, harsh of angry words, and idle gossip.

3 of the Mind

Ignorance, desire and anger, or greed and hostility

The problem is that we tend to treat these 3 poisons more as words but, it needs to be take to the personal level of  "I"

To understand Kharma and to be able to get a hold of it so that it doesn't get a hold of us, we need to know that there are two kinds of Kharma; "Throwing Kharma" and "Ripening Kharma." They are best explained as that which we put out into the atmosphere and that which ripens upon us from our past actions.
